+bool CompositingReasonFinder::requiresCompositingForScrollBlocksOn(const RenderObject* renderer) const
+{
+ // Note that the other requires* functions run at RenderObject::styleDidChange time and so can rely
+ // only on the style of their object. This function runs at CompositingRequirementsUpdater::update
+ // time, and so can consider the style of other objects.
+ RenderStyle* style = renderer->style();
+
+ // We should only get here by CompositingReasonScrollBlocksOn being a potential compositing reason.
+ ASSERT(style->hasScrollBlocksOn() && !renderer->isDocumentElement());
+
+ // scroll-blocks-on style is propagated from the document element to the document.
+ ASSERT(!renderer->isRenderView()
+ || !renderer->document().documentElement()
+ || !renderer->document().documentElement()->renderer()
+ || renderer->document().documentElement()->renderer()->style()->scrollBlocksOn() == style->scrollBlocksOn());
+
+ // When a scroll occurs, it's the union of all bits set on the target element's containing block
+ // chain that determines the behavior. Thus we really only need a new layer if this object contains
+ // additional bits from those set by all objects in it's containing block chain. But determining
+ // this fully is probably more expensive than it's worth. Instead we just have fast-paths here for
+ // the most common cases of unnecessary layer creation.
+ // Optimizing this fully would avoid layer explosion in pathological cases like '*' rules.
+ // We could consider tracking the current state in CompositingRequirementsUpdater::update.
+
+ // Ensure iframes don't get composited when they require no more blocking than the root.
+ if (renderer->isRenderView()) {
+ if (const FrameView* parentFrame = toRenderView(renderer)->frameView()->parentFrameView()) {
+ if (const RenderView* parentRenderer = parentFrame->renderView()) {
+ // Does this frame contain only blocks-on bits already present in the parent frame?
+ if (!(style->scrollBlocksOn() & ~parentRenderer->style()->scrollBlocksOn()))
+ return false;
+ }
+ }
+ }
+
+ return true;
+}
